Based on 22 Wall Street analysts who have issued ratings for Royal Caribbean Cruises in the last 12 months, the stock has a consensus rating of "Moderate Buy." Out of the 22 analysts, 6 have given a hold rating, 15 have given a buy rating, and 1 has given a strong buy rating for RCL.

According to the 22 analysts' twelve-month price targets for Royal Caribbean Cruises, the average price target is $346.80. The highest price target for RCL is $425.00, while the lowest price target for RCL is $280.00. The average price target represents a forecasted upside of 22.92% from the current price of $282.13.
MarketBeat calculates consensus analyst ratings for stocks using the most recent rating from each Wall Street analyst that has rated a stock within the last twelve months. Each analyst's rating is normalized to a standardized rating score of 1 (sell), 2 (hold), 3 (buy) or 4 (strong buy). Analyst consensus ratings scores are calculated using the mean average of the number of normalized sell, hold, buy and strong buy ratings from Wall Street analysts. Each stock's consensus analyst rating is derived from its calculated consensus ratings score (0 to .5 = Strong Sell, .5 to 1 = Sell, 1 to 1.5 = Reduce, 1.5 to 2.5 = Hold, 2.5 to 3.0 = Moderate Buy, 3.0 to 3.5 = Buy, >3.5 = Strong Buy). MarketBeat's consensus price targets are a mean average of the most recent available price targets set by each analyst that has set a price target for the stock in the last twelve months. MarketBeat's consensus ratings and consensus price targets may differ from those calculated by other firms due to differences in methodology and available data.
